QA Automation Engineer

Kyiv, Ukraine

Overview

We are looking for an experienced QA Automation Engineer who would like to become a part of the team that builds real solutions for real users and works with the latest technologies & frameworks.

Requirements:

  • 3+ years of commercial automating experience (Python, JS)
  • QA experience/knowledge
  • Experience with API Automation testing
  • Solid programming skills with Python or JS
  • Hands-on experience with building automation test platform for functional and non-functional testing and with related tools
  • CI/CD experience (Jenkins / AWS CodeBuild)
  • Experience with Selenium, Cypress, Docker, Jenkins
  • API (curl, postman, python-requests)
  • Upper-intermediate level of English

Enkonix benefits:

  • 100% taxes compensation
  • 100% compensation the road to/from the office (Uber or gas)
  • Paid vacation — 18 working days per year
  • Paid sick leaves
  • Paid public holidays according to Ukrainian legislation
  • Medical insurance with A++ clinics coverage
  • Salary reviews every 6 months
  • Performance review twice a year, with goals check every 2 months
  • Comfortable working place with Macbook M1, Display 28″ 4k, and an e-table
  • 50% of courses compensation
  • Career development, knowledge sharing, and training opportunities
  • Free corporate English lessons
  • Friendly teammates and corporate social events
  • Support with personal projects and opportunities to take new roles & responsibility
  • 5-day working week from Monday to Friday (Wednesdays are optionally remote)
  • 8-hour working day

Responsibility:

As a QA Automation Engineer, you’ll be responsible for the quality of the web and mobile products. Day to day work would imply:

  • Help to design, build and maintain a platform for functional and non-functional testing of a microservices application, including reporting and tests results visualization
  • Research and evaluate technical options to implement project requirements
  • Perform functional and non-functional test cases design, automation and review
  • Mastering the product — provide hands-on quality direction
  • Analyzing and processing product requirements
  • Driving exploratory testing, authoring test plans and test cases, as well as regression suits for the product
  • Taking part in continuous process improvement

About us:

Enkonix is a technology consulting organization that connects strategy, design, and engineering services into a seamless workflow devised to support clients every step of the way. Over the past 5 years, we have designed and built a diverse range of high-quality products from scratch. Our specialists have expertise in various spheres including e-learning, healthcare, e-commerce, advertising, augmented reality, finance, sharing economy, and many more.

You have the chance to become a part of the team that builds real solutions for real users and works with the latest technologies & frameworks. This is your unique opportunity to contribute to the product that will be used worldwide and impact the industry.

We use the Kanban methodology and the following technology stack for this project:

  • Back-end: Python3+, Django, Django REST Framework, PostgreSQL, Redis, Celery, Daphne, Gunicorn.
  • Front-end: Vue.js, Nuxt.js, Vuex, Vuetify.
  • Other: Git (Bitbucket), CI/CD with Jenkins/AWS Codebuild, Nginx, Supervisor.
  • AWS stack: EC2, S3, RDS, SNS, SQS, ECS, CloudFormation, Fargate, Codebuild, Route53, Cloudfront.